IP查询
查询
你查询的IP:[218.222.135.204] 地理位置:日本
最新查询
120.131.36.184
60.30.255.34
119.241.121.18
221.174.148.218
219.128.29.5
221.14.4.112
119.161.83.205
60.241.197.176
119.146.25.148
218.222.135.204
203.184.80.53
116.16.0.72
121.79.128.150
117.74.128.220
116.95.168.104
59.172.5.142
221.200.55.80
117.44.0.226
198.17.7.245
203.130.32.240
118.242.193.216
120.92.62.172
203.100.192.205
125.31.192.70
119.28.170.82
219.82.238.38
123.184.174.63
202.46.224.222
61.128.36.58
60.252.94.34
117.106.215.152